The museum, hosted in the House of Music - Palazzo Cusani, with objects, affiches, photos, videso, music, information technology. and instruments on display illustres four centuries of opera on stage in Parma.
Dedicated to a wide range of visitors, students as well as opera lovers and experts, the Museum is divided into four halls: two of them focusing on the development of music theatre in Parma and its protagonists and two dedicated to Giuseppe Verdi and its relationship with the town and its culture.
The museum is equipped with SeSaMoNet, a guide and navigation system that allows visually impaired people to listen to images and documents on display through a special stick with a Rfid reader given at the entrance.The museum staff can lead the visitors in guided tours, even in English, French, German, Spanish and Japanese.
